Glentoran 09/10 Umbro Away Kit

As JJB Sports Premiership Champions Glentoran prepare for the defence of the title, supporters have been eagerly awaiting the release of the brand new Umbro 2009/2010 away kit.  Today the club revealed the brand new kit that will be available to buy from this coming Friday.

The kit launch event will kick off on Thursday night at Connswater at around 9pm with a cavalcade of music and sound, prize giveaways, big screen highlights of the league winning season, good food and refreshments.  Top of the bill will be a fashion show fronted by first team players and fans who will reveal the fantastic all new official training and leisurewear collection for Season 09/10.

The unique and stunning new away kit will be on sale at midnight on Thursday 28th May at Connswater Shopping Centre, home of the new Glentoran Superstore!

There will be player interviews throughout the evening and of course and opportunity for autographs and photographs with the Gibson Cup also in attendance!
